Understanding Titration Prescriptions: The Science of Personalized Dosing

In the world of contemporary medication, the "one-size-fits-all" technique is progressively being replaced by precision pharmacology. One of the most critical tools in this personalized approach is the titration prescription. A titration prescription is a medical procedure where a doctor gradually changes the dose of a medication to achieve the maximum therapeutic result with the minimum number of negative effects.

This procedure acknowledges that every specific possesses a distinct biological makeup, affected by genetics, body weight, age, and metabolism. Subsequently, how a single person reacts to 10mg of a drug might vary considerably from how another individual reacts to the exact same dose. The Purpose of Titration

The main goal of a titration prescription is to find the "restorative window"-- the dosage range where a drug is reliable without being harmful. For many medications, the difference between an inadequate dose, a healing dosage, and a harmful dosage is narrow.

Titration serves three primary functions:

  1. Safety: By starting with a low "sub-therapeutic" dosage, clinicians can keep an eye on for allergic responses or severe negative effects before the concentration of the drug reaches greater levels.
  2. Tolerability: Gradually increasing a dosage permits the body to accustom to the drug's presence, often decreasing the seriousness of initial adverse effects like queasiness, dizziness, or tiredness.
  3. Efficacy: Titration ensures that a patient does not take more medication than is needed to treat their condition, thus lowering long-lasting risks.

Common Medications Requiring Titration

Not all drugs need titration. For example, a basic course of prescription antibiotics generally includes a fixed dose. Nevertheless, medications that impact the main nerve system, cardiovascular system, or metabolic processes typically necessitate a progressive modification.

Table 1: Common Therapeutic Areas and Titrated Medications

Healing CategoryExample MedicationsReason for Titration
CardiologyBeta-blockers, ACE inhibitorsTo prevent sudden drops in high blood pressure or heart rate.
NeurologyAnti-seizure medications (e.g., Gabapentin)To keep an eye on for cognitive adverse effects and make sure seizure control.
PsychiatryAntidepressants, Antipsychotics, StimulantsTo discover the balance between mood stabilization and sedation.
EndocrinologyInsulin, Thyroid hormonesTo match physiological requirements based upon blood sugar level or TSH levels.
Discomfort ManagementNon-steroidal anti-inflammatories, OpioidsTo handle pain levels while keeping an eye on for respiratory depression or reliance.

The Mechanics of a Titration Schedule

A titration prescription is usually broken down into specific stages. These stages are outlined plainly in the prescribing guidelines to make sure the patient understands exactly when and how to change their dosage.

The Up-Titration Process

Up-titration involves starting at a low dose and increasing it at set periods. This prevails with medications for ADHD (like Methylphenidate) or chronic discomfort.

Example of a 4-Week Up-Titration Schedule:

WeekEarly morning DoseEvening DoseTotal Daily Dose
Week 15 mg0 mg5 mg
Week 25 mg5 mg10 mg
Week 310 mg5 mg15 mg
Week 4 (Target)10 mg10 mg20 mg

The Down-Titration (Tapering) Process

On the other hand, some medications can not be stopped suddenly. Down-titration, frequently called tapering, is required to prevent withdrawal symptoms or "rebound" results, where the initial signs return more severely. This is common with corticosteroids, benzodiazepines, and certain antidepressants.

Benefits of Titration Prescriptions

Executing a titration schedule provides a number of medical and mental advantages for the client:

  • Minimized Adverse Drug Reactions (ADRs): By presenting the chemical gradually, the body's countervailing mechanisms can change, preventing "shock" to the system.
  • Client Confidence: Patients are frequently more compliant with treatment when they feel they have control over the procedure and are not overwhelmed by instant, intense side results.
  • Precision Medicine: It allows medical professionals to account for "sluggish metabolizers" (people whose bodies process drugs slowly) and "quick metabolizers" (people who require greater doses to see any impact).
  • Cost-Effectiveness: Finding the most affordable reliable dosage can conserve the patient money and reduce the burden on the health care system by avoiding unnecessary over-medication.

Standards for Patients Undergoing Titration

When a patient is prescribed a titration schedule, their function shifts from a passive recipient to an active observer. Success depends greatly on the patient's ability to follow guidelines and interact feedback.

Secret obligations for the client include:

  • Strict Adherence: Never skip an action in the titration schedule. Increasing the dose too rapidly can be dangerous, while staying on a low dose too long may postpone healing.
  • Sign Tracking: Keeping a log or journal of how they feel each day helps the doctor identify if the dosage needs to be increased further or preserved.
  • Timely Communication: If a side effect ends up being excruciating during an increase, the client must contact their supplier immediately instead of stopping the medication entirely.
  • Consistency: Taking the medication at the same time every day to guarantee blood plasma levels remain steady.

Difficulties and Risks

In spite of its benefits, titration is not without its obstacles. The most substantial obstacle is complexity. Patients might become puzzled by altering dosages, causing medication mistakes. To mitigate this, many pharmacies offer "blister packs" or "titration loads" that are pre-labeled with the date and time of each dose.

Another threat is the lag time. Because titration begins at a low dosage, it might take weeks and even months for the patient to feel the full restorative advantage of the drug. This can result in disappointment and the mistaken belief that the medication "isn't working."

Often Asked Questions (FAQ)

1. Why can't I just start at the highest dose to feel better faster?

Beginning at a high dose increases the danger of toxicity and severe negative effects. Numerous medications need the body to develop up a tolerance or permit receptors in the brain to adjust gradually. Beginning too high can "overload" your system, possibly resulting in emergency situation medical scenarios.

2. What should I do if I miss out on a dosage throughout my titration schedule?

Normally, you ought to take the missed dose as quickly as you keep in mind, unless it is practically time for your next dose. However, you must never ever double the dose to "catch up" without consulting your doctor or pharmacist, as this might interrupt the prepared titration.

4. Can I titrate myself if I feel the medication isn't working?

No. Titrating a medication without professional guidance is very harmful. Some medications can trigger heart arrhythmias, seizures, or serious psychological distress if not adjusted correctly according to medicinal concepts.

5. Does every medication need a titration schedule?

No. Lots of medications, such as standard prescription antibiotics or one-time treatments, have actually a fixed dose that is efficient for the large bulk of the population. Titration is scheduled for drugs where the healing window is narrow or the reaction varies widely between individuals.
